(hereinafter referred to as the "Operator") uses cookie files. A cookie is a small text file that some websites store on your computer. Cookie files serve the proper functionality of websites, helping for example to complete the process of services provided by the Operator or to remember your login credentials, so that these details do not need to be entered again. However, based on the information obtained by the Operator through cookies, it is not possible to identify a specific person, and the Operator does not combine cookies with other data for the purpose of such identification. Details about cookies on the Platform are based on categories of cookies found in the International Chamber of Commerce guide, according to which cookies are divided into the following categories:

Strictly necessary

These cookie files are essential so that you can navigate the website and use special features of the site, such as access to a secure area of the website. Without these essential cookies, some parts of the website cannot be used. Persistent cookies are not generally used in this category unless it is truly necessary.

Performance

These cookies allow the website to store user preferences such as, for example, language settings. They provide the user with an enhanced and more personalised use of the website. These cookies cannot collect information about the user's activities on other websites.

Functional

These cookies may include cookies providing services at the user's request. These cookie files collect information about the user's behaviour. This information is part of reports whose purpose is to improve the website. All collected data is anonymous.

Targeted and advertising

These cookies are used to display advertising that is relevant to the user and their interests. These cookies can also be used to store and measure the effectiveness of an advertising campaign that the customer encountered during a visit to specific websites. This also enables better communication with potential advertisers.
